URL: From lillie.gray at state.or.us Fri May 9 13:37:03 2014 From: lillie.gray at state.or.us (GRAY Lillie) Date: Fri, 9 May 2014 20:37:03 +0000 Subject: [Busmgrs] Request for Proposals - transition Network Facilitator (ODE number 5401) Message-ID: <4371e0e1404143f6bda83739f5df3e9b@BLUPR04MB260.namprd04.prod.outlook.com> The Oregon Department of Education, Procurement Services Unit, releases on behalf of the Office of Learning- Student Services, a Request for Proposals (RFP) No. 5401 - Transition Network Facilitator. Per Governor's Executive Order Number 13-04 - Providing Employment Services to Individuals with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ities, the Agency is directed to establish a Statewide Transition Technical Assistance Network to assist high schools in Oregon to provide Transition Services. The purpose of this Request for Proposals (RFP) is to award eight (8) contracts to qualified School Districts and Educational Service Districts (ESD) who will recruit a Transition Network Facilitator for their District or Region. Name: Business Manager-Deputy Clerk 2013-2014.docx Type: application/vnd.openxmlformats-officedocument.wordprocessingml.document Size: 23238 bytes Desc: Business Manager-Deputy Clerk 2013-2014.docx URL: From lillie.gray at state.or.us Thu May 15 08:54:57 2014 From: lillie.gray at state.or.us (GRAY Lillie) Date: Thu, 15 May 2014 15:54:57 +0000 Subject: [Busmgrs] Local Assessment Capacity Building Contract Opportunity Message-ID: <9f34236f458944289dbe9fdb6131c3b9@CO1PR04MB267.namprd04.prod.outlook.com> As a part of Oregon's Strategic Initiatives, specifically, House Bill 3233, the Oregon Department of Education (ODE) is seeking four district partners to focus on developing local assessment capacity and to become regional ambassadors for how to develop local assessment capacity. Each of the four districts will participate in a series of trainings and tasks and develop at least two Common Core standards-aligned assessments, with graded student work, for grades three through twelve. Districts will be selected to develop either English Language Arts and Literacy assessments or Mathematics assessments. Each of the four districts will receive $100,000, which means the district will be able to provide approximately $9,000 of release time per grade for teachers and $10,000 for coordination and dissemination. You may access the audio and handouts from the presentation at https://district.ode.state.or.us/search/page/?id=234 then scroll down to Budget Expenditures/Revenues 14-15 - April 10, 2014 : Question - If there is an empty spot (or two) on the budget committee, what number is needed for a quorum? Answer - If, after a good faith attempt, the governing body cannot find a sufficient number of registered voters who are willing to serve, the budget committee becomes those who are willing plus the governing body. If no willing electors can be found, the governing body is the budget committee. ([ORS 294.414(2), renumbered from 294.336(2)] (reference page 44, Local Budget Manual)). So once the size of the committee is determined, a quorum becomes one half the total plus one. Please be reminded that any budget committee action requires the affirmative vote of a majority of the total budget committee membership [OAR 150-294.336-(B), implementing ORS 294.414]. For example, if only six members of a 10-member committee are present, they have the quorum necessary to meet, but they all must vote in favor of any proposed action to achieve the required majority. (Reference page 45, Local Budget Manual). Question - Is the Allocating Bond Taxes worksheet for bond levies or bond issues? Answer - As per the Department of Revenue, "The worksheet is for allocating the bond levies for the upcoming tax year. Districts only need to worry about it if they have both a bond that was approved by the voters before October 6, 2001 and also a bond approved by the voters on or after October 6, 2001." Question - Can function code 1410, Elementary Summer School, be used for coding federal funds? Answer - Yes. As a rule, expenditures should be coded to the programs they support. Question - Does the ED 50 Bond Worksheet need to be included in the budget submission to ODE? Answer - No. Question - What is the definition of a "General Purpose Grant?" Answer - With regard to individual grants received, a general purpose grant would be unrestricted funds. With regard to the State School Fund calculations, the general purpose grant is defined in ORS 327.013(1). Question - Referencing slide 14 of the presentation, please confirm that the reports presented to the Budget Committee need to have a column that is the 13-14 Working Budget as opposed to the 13-14 Adopted Budget. Answer - As per the Department of Revenue, "Budgets amended by supplemental budget should include the updated numbers in the "adopted budget this year" column. We have some debate on whether or not changes made by resolution are part of the current adopted budget; so you're welcome to go either way by including these numbers or not. My suggestion would be to make a notation at the bottom of the page to indicate whether or not the changes made by resolution are included in your numbers." That's it for the questions posed.
